First of all, the AK47 was actually called that. It was a habit. It was widely known in the world not as AK47, but as an improved model, AKM.    

    

A represented the automatic gun, and K was the first letter of Karashniv's name, so it could be called the AK series.    

    

The AK-47 was set in 1947, so it was called AK-47. It began to equip large amounts of Bear Country troops in 1949, which was the most reliable automatic rifle in the world. It was durable, had low malfunction, was reliable, and had a simple structure. It was easy to disassemble, and the production cost was also very low.    

    

However, this gun also had many small problems, so Karasinkov also made many improvements to this gun. After the modifications, it was called AKM.    

    

There were many aspects of improvement, such as reducing the weight of the rifle and using a large number of press components. He also changed the rivets to welding. For example, the gun barrel and tail were welded to the 1mm thick U-shaped box. The frame - the gun's rail would also be pressed and welded on the inner wall of the box; the magazine would be changed to a light alloy, which could be used with the original steel box. Later on, he also developed a kind of magazine made of glass fiber plastic compression, which could also be used completely. The gun handle, the wood shield, and the handle were synthesized with resin.    

    

Some information explained that AKM used a foldable gun handle. This M meant the folding gun butt, which was a complete misunderstanding. The foldable gun butt was prepared for some troops, such as the Mechanist. When riding the Infantry Tank, the foldable gun butt was easy to shoot in the car. The normal troops used the same model of the retractable gun handle.
